Output 5fc30c6ee07d14a820f9e9e00dd130e037c502328645197a8939738e260b3067:20

value
705973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9295bd8f9fe61e152208d132edd99fc8436c840d OP_EQUAL
address
3F45xhduHVgJUz8BQ8EkFCSHVnmZpokZw6
transaction
5fc30c6ee07d14a820f9e9e00dd130e037c502328645197a8939738e260b3067
spent
true